To make the most of your Bristol Open Mic experience, it’s crucial to come prepared. Practice your act well in advance, ensuring that you have a stellar performance ready. Respect the time limits set by the host, allowing everyone a fair chance to perform. And don’t forget to bring along a supportive friend or two, as they can help calm those pre-performance nerves and share the excitement of experiencing live art.
